The South Korea Small Wind Turbine Market was estimated at USD 169 Million in 2025 and is projected to reach USD 239 Million by 2032, growing at a CAGR of 5.1% from 2026 to 2032. This growth is primarily fueled by increasing awareness of renewable energy sources among consumers and small businesses, alongside substantial government support aimed at enhancing clean energy adoption. With advances in technology that improve efficiency and reduce costs, small wind turbines are becoming an increasingly attractive option for energy independence.
The South Korean small wind turbine market has exhibited stable growth, with annual increases of 5.8% in 2021, rising to 6.3% in 2023. This upward trend is largely attributed to the government's robust support for renewable energy initiatives and an increasing consumer demand for sustainable power sources. In 2024, however, growth is projected to stabilize at 5.9%, reflecting a slight adjustment as market players recalibrate to competitive pressures and evolving technologies. By 2030, growth is again expected to rise to 6.3%, driven by advancements in turbine efficiency and infrastructure improvements. Investments in digitalization and smart energy management systems are further enhancing market dynamics, ensuring long-term viability beyond the current decade.

Despite a positive outlook, the South Korea small wind turbine market faces significant restraints. Limited land availability in urbanized areas hampers the installation of wind turbines, making it a daunting task for potential customers. Furthermore, navigating through regulatory barriers can be an arduous process, often delaying project approvals and deterring investment. The high initial costs for purchasing and installing these systems can also act as a deterrent for individuals and small businesses, complicating efforts to capitalize on available incentives. Addressing these challenges will be crucial for the market's overall growth.

The South Korean government has undertaken a series of initiatives to bolster the small wind turbine market. These include the Renewable Portfolio Standard (RPS), which mandates that a certain percentage of electricity generated must come from renewable sources, including wind power. Financial incentives like feed-in tariffs and tax credits are also in place to promote the adoption of small wind turbines. Furthermore, a certification system ensures the quality and safety of installed turbines, fostering trust among consumers and investors.
